Comprehensive Substance Use Evaluation

The evaluation process begins with a detailed psychiatric and substance use assessment. We examine patterns of use, frequency, duration, and functional impact while also reviewing mental health history, medical background, and prior treatment experiences. This comprehensive assessment helps determine whether substance use meets clinical criteria for a disorder, identifies co-occurring psychiatric conditions, and establishes the severity level necessary to guide appropriate care.

Diagnostic Clarification & Risk Assessment

Substance use often overlaps with mood disorders, anxiety disorders, trauma-related conditions, or other psychiatric diagnoses. Careful diagnostic clarification ensures that treatment addresses both substance-related concerns and any underlying or co-occurring mental health conditions. We also assess risk factors, including withdrawal potential, safety concerns, and environmental stressors, to determine the safest and most effective level of care.

Individualized Treatment Planning

Following evaluation, we develop a personalized treatment plan focused on stabilization and sustainable recovery. Treatment planning may include medication management when clinically appropriate, coordination with therapy services, referral to higher levels of care when necessary, and structured follow-up for monitoring progress. Goals are clearly defined and aligned with both symptom reduction and functional improvement.

Medication-Assisted Treatment

For certain substance use disorders, medication-assisted treatment may be clinically indicated to reduce cravings, manage withdrawal symptoms, and lower the risk of relapse. When appropriate, medications are prescribed and monitored within a structured framework to ensure safety, effectiveness, and adherence. All treatment decisions are made collaboratively and grounded in evidence-based standards of care.
